Southwest Airlines Executive Assistant Salaries in Boulder

The average Southwest Airlines Executive Assistant in Boulder earns an estimated $75,566 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$69,283 with a $6,283 bonus. Southwest Airlines' Executive Assistant compensation is $9,736 more than the US average for a Executive Assistant. Executive Assistant salaries at Southwest Airlines in Boulder can range from $25,000 - $162,000.
